Design Grad Hired by Top Regional Firm

by Natalia Kirychuk, Public Relations Writer – October 27, 2016

Visual communication design grad hired by leading web design firm

Cedarville University’s visual communication design program can claim another high-profile placement, as 2016 graduate Andrew Spencer accepted a frontend design position last month at Sparkbox, a leading web design studio based in Dayton.  

During the last week of Spencer’s final semester at Cedarville, his web design class visited Sparkbox – a company that had been on Spencer’s radar for years. After learning that they had an opening that fit his skills, he applied and was accepted into Sparkbox’s apprenticeship program.
A full-service web design studio, Sparkbox works with organizations to develop and design websites and applications. The company – an industry leader – also offers professional design and development workshops around the Dayton area.

As an apprentice, Spencer spent three months honing his HTML and CSS coding skills. And when the apprenticeship ended, Sparkbox offered him a full-time position as a frontend designer, and Spencer now builds and designs websites for what he calls a fun and hardworking company. 

“I enjoy the diversity of the work that I do, and no two days are ever the same,” Spencer said. “I’m able to work on multiple projects at once, and I help the team create the best work possible for our clients. The people are the biggest factor in making it an enjoyable and exciting job.”

Spencer credits Cedarville’s visual communication design professors with preparing him well for his work at Sparkbox. 

“I truly appreciate my professors’ intentionality and the effort they put into helping me become a well-rounded design professional who seeks to honor Christ with my work. They pushed me to do my best.”
